In this episode of Coffee and Conversation, hosted by Candler Career Services, we welcome Rev. Dr. Eunil David Cho and The Rev. Marisa Sifontes, JD for a rich and deeply reflective conversation about calling, second‑career discernment, and theological education as formation.Rev. Sifontes, an Episcopal priest and Associate Rector at St. James Church in Manhattan, reflects on her mid‑career transition from a 20‑year legal career into ministry, navigating seminary with children, and discovering how God uses every skill and season of life. Rev. Dr. Cho, Assistant Professor of Spiritual Care and Counseling at Boston University School of Theology and an ordained Presbyterian minister, shares how his journey as an educator, pastor, scholar, and immigrant shaped his vocational path and his work with refugee and undocumented communities.Recorded live with students, this episode explores seminary as a place to bring your full self—questions, uncertainty, and all—while learning to show up with humility, courage, and care.☕ In this episode, we explore:• Second‑career discernment and mid‑life vocational pivots• Balancing family, formation, and ministry• Con Ed, CPE, and learning to “show up” in unfamiliar spaces• Ministry beyond the church: law, education, refugee support, and advocacy• Integrating lived experience into scholarship and pastoral care• The role of community in sustaining ministry before and after seminary• Seminary as a safe place to struggle, ask questions, and become wholeRev. Dr. Cho also reflects on his book (adapted from his dissertation), which centers the stories of undocumented young people and draws from his theological formation, pastoral practice, and lived experience.Coffee and Conversation, hosted by Candler Career Services, creates space for alumni wisdom, student listening, and honest conversations about faith, vocation, and becoming.Grab your coffee and join the conversation.
